Output 96b3350153dbd62387a6da08424834ecf4cfff45c2c9115f215cbf8d90156a59:0

value
27537986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3f42808762e5b37cf94fe1df836c360daab3b54 OP_EQUAL
address
3GdvZ6SwyEVWNazfqiTysR3j1ZZ1ssbio4
transaction
96b3350153dbd62387a6da08424834ecf4cfff45c2c9115f215cbf8d90156a59
spent
true